Speedo pulse generator diagnosis with analog VOM 700 1992

As I delve ever deeper into the inner workings of the Yazaki...


I have my speedo disassembled, and note first of all, that the magnetic pulse *is* modified before it is fed back off to the cruise control. Just for anyone that digs this out of the archives in the future.

Here is my question:

I notice that the wires that make the speedometer go are four:

1. 12v
2. Ground
3. S+
4. S-


I know what 1 and 2 are. They seem fine.

I assume that S+ and S- are coming from the rear end pulse generator.

I have an old (15+ years) analog RadioShack VOM. It has two ammeter settings:

250m
25u(250mV)


I'm guessing that is 250 miliamps and 25 microamps max measurable at 250 milivolts (or about .07 watts max).

Can I just stick the VOM on one of those settings, connect the leads red to S+ and black to S- and see if I get something out of the generator as I drive down the road? Can this hurt the sensor? Which setting? 250m or 25u
